What is Hair Transplantation?

Hair transplantation is a surgical procedure that involves moving hair follicles from a donor site, usually the back of the head, to a balding or thinning area. This technique allows for natural hair growth in areas where hair loss has occurred. The two primary methods of hair transplantation are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E).
FUT involves removing a strip of scalp from the donor area and then dissecting it into individual follicular units for transplantation. On the other hand, FUE involves extracting individual follicular units directly from the scalp without the need for a linear incision. Both methods have their pros and cons, and the choice often depends on the patient’s condition and preferences.
The key to a successful hair transplant is the skill and experience of the surgeon. A qualified specialist can ensure that the procedure is performed correctly, leading to natural-looking results and minimal scarring.
Benefits of Hair Transplantation
The most significant advantage of hair transplantation is its ability to provide a permanent solution to hair loss. Unlike topical treatments or medications that may require ongoing use, transplanted hair follicles are typically resistant to the hormone responsible for hair loss and can grow for a lifetime.
Additionally, hair transplantation can enhance self-esteem and improve quality of life. Many individuals report feeling more confident and satisfied with their appearance post-procedure. This psychological benefit is often overlooked but is just as important as the physical results.
Furthermore, advancements in technology have made hair transplantation safer and more effective. Techniques such as robotic-assisted surgery and advanced imaging systems are enhancing precision and minimizing recovery time.

Post-Procedure Care and Recovery
Proper post-operative care is vital for ensuring the success of a hair transplant. Surgeons typically provide specific instructions on how to care for the scalp after the procedure. This may include avoiding strenuous activities, protecting the scalp from sun exposure, and adhering to a prescribed regimen of medications.
Most patients can resume normal activities within a few days, but complete recovery may take several weeks. During this time, it is common for transplanted hair to shed before new growth begins. This shedding, known as “shock loss,” is a natural part of the process.
Regular follow-up appointments with the surgeon are important to monitor progress and address any concerns that may arise during the recovery phase.
